Dharmendra Pradhan, the Union Education and Skill Development Minister, has launched a 100-day reading campaign 'Padhe Bharat'.



The campaign signifies an important step towards improving the learning levels of students as it develops critical thinking, vocabulary, creativity, and the ability to express both in writing and verbally, as per the official statement.



The launch of the Padhe Bharat Reading Campaign is in line with the NEP (National Education Policy) 2020 which highlights the advancements of joyful reading culture for children by guaranteeing the availability of age-appropriate reading books in their mother tongue/ regional/ tribal language.



The focus of the campaign will be on the students studying in Balvatika to Class 08.



The campaign will continue for 14 weeks and one activity per week has been designed for each group with the aim of making reading enjoyable and building a lifelong partnership with the joy of reading. The Campaign will start from Jan 01 and will continue till April 10, 2022.



The Govt, as part of the Padhe Bharat Campaign, has also shared a detailed guideline with the states and UTs having a weekly calendar of activities divided according to the age groups.



The students can perform these activities within the comfort of their homes with the help of resources. The guidelines also allow students to take help from family or peers in case their schools are shut.
